Sports & Fitness Events in Dublin — Your Complete Guide

Sports events in Dublin span everything from elite professional fixtures to community fun runs, charity swims and local sports days. Whether you're a dedicated sports fan, a casual participant, or a parent looking for active family activities, Dublin's sporting calendar has something for everyone.

The city's professional teams play regularly at home throughout the season, and attending a live match remains one of the most electric experiences any city has to offer. Beyond the big stadiums, Dublin has a thriving grassroots sports scene — amateur football leagues, running clubs, cycling sportives, martial arts competitions, swimming galas, and athletics meetings all fill the diary.

Participation events are particularly popular: 5K charity runs, obstacle course races, open-water swims, and cycling events with mass participation draw thousands of residents each year. These events combine the buzz of sporting competition with a strong community and charitable spirit.

Fitness classes and bootcamps held in parks and community centres are a staple of the Dublin sports calendar, particularly during spring and summer. Many are free or low-cost, making regular exercise accessible for people at all income levels. Whether you want to watch, compete, or simply get moving, Dublin's sports events are a great place to start.
